Job Summary & ResponsibilitiesPrimary Purpose
Owns process performance for a line, cell, or technology module and directs high‑impact changes that improve stability, capacity, and cost. Integrates new products and equipment into production through structured validation and knowledge transfer.
Duties and Responsibilities
  • Leads scale‑up and validation for new or modified processes and ensures complete, auditable evidence of readiness.
  • Specifies and justifies equipment or control upgrades; supervises installation, commissioning, and acceptance testing.
  • Establishes monitoring plans and key indicators that trigger corrective actions and continuous improvement.
  • Directs complex troubleshooting and implements sustainable fixes that balance safety, quality, cost, and delivery.
  • Drives layout optimization, material flow, and changeover reduction to increase throughput and flexibility.
  • Ensures changes meet regulatory and environmental requirements and that documentation and training are current.
  • Leads cross‑functional reviews and communicates decisions, risks, and mitigations to leadership.
  • Coaches peers in structured methods (risk assessment, designed experiments, simulation) and review discipline.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
